  • Abstract
    Finite element analysis of saturable lossy magnetic components is extended to include the effects of time-varying circuit elements. Resistors, capacitors and inductors are varied in time using coupled nonlinear transient electromagnetic and structural finite elements. Examples show how changing the size of certain finite elements produces the desired time variations of R, C and L, and that the resulting voltages are accurately computed. Also, a time-varying capacitor is placed on the secondary of a saturating transformer with eddy currents in its core, and the computed secondary voltage is shown to be highly dependent on both the time variation and the core conductivity
